NEW YORK STATE ELKS ASSOCIATION SPRING CONVENTION HIGHLIGHTS ELKS BELIEVE, ELKS ACHIEVEThe 104 th Annual Convention of the New York State Elks Association and Spring Meeting of the New York Elks Major Projects, Inc. was held at the Radison Hotel-Rochester Riverside in Rochester New York from May 19, 2016 to May 22, 2016. The convention was attended by members and quests representing Lodges from throughout the State. The convention featured a Memorial Ceremony that recognized Past Exalted Ruler who passed the past year, special Camp Committee Question and Answer sessions, workshops that were well attended by Association members, announcement of Scholarship winners, the State Association Ritual Contest and Award Presentations, a general business session and a closing business session. During the convention workshop, numerous members and Lodges were recognized with awards. The award presentations are featured in the pages that follow. Special convention guests included Endorsed Grand Exalted Ruler candidate Michael F Zellen and Grand Lodge National Membership, Public Relations Manager Rick Gathen and National Hoop Shoot Champion Cameron Orr of Glens Falls, New York. Endorsed candidate Zellen provided encouraging words about Elkdom to the attending members during the closing session and during the Gala Banquet. Membership and Public Relations Manager Gathen presented at both the Public Relations and Membership workshop and had big gatherings at both. And National Hoop Shoot Champion Orr spoke about his preparation and thoughts on being a National Champion. During the closing session, the members voted on the camp proposal. The vote on the camp passed with 71% in favor. A 2/3 majority vote was required. The Ritual contest featured the talents of six very competitive Ritual teams that saw Wolcott Lodge #1763 winning with a score of 94.605. The convention closed the Gala State Banquet and closing ceremonies that included the Installation of State Officers, including Bill Reedy Jr. as new State President for 2016-2017 and his team of State Vice Presidents, and the Presentation of Ritual Awards.
